Locally acquired hepatitis E virus infection, El Paso, Texas
Joseph J Amon1, Jan Drobeniuc, William A Bower
1Epidemic Intelligence Service, Epidemiology Program Office, Centers for Disease Control and Prevention, Atlanta, Georgia 30333, USA. joe_j_amon@yahoo.com
Hepatitis E virus (HEV) causes acute hepatitis. A Texas case, genetically similar to US swine HEV, highlights potential local transmission despite no clear infection source, indicating a need for further investigation.

Background:
- Hepatitis E virus (HEV) is an enterically transmitted RNA virus responsible for epidemic and sporadic acute hepatitis.
- While HEV antibodies are prevalent in the US population (up to 36%), reported cases of acute hepatitis E without international travel history are rare.
Observation:
- This report details a case of acute hepatitis E in El Paso, Texas, with no travel history.
- The identified HEV strain showed 98% genetic similarity to a previously isolated HEV strain found in US swine.
Findings:
- Despite thorough investigation, no definitive source of HEV infection was identified for this patient.
- Active surveillance did not reveal additional cases in the region.
Implications:
- This case suggests a potential for locally-acquired hepatitis E in the United States, possibly linked to zoonotic transmission from swine.
- Further research is needed to understand the epidemiology and transmission routes of HEV within the US population.
- Enhanced surveillance may be necessary to detect and manage non-travel-associated hepatitis E cases.
